How much do full time ranch j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 21,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time ranch in Rockwall, TX is $16.17,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.41 and $18.12 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a full time ranch job?

Full-time ranch jobs involve working on a ranch or farm as a primary occupation, often including tasks such as caring for livestock, maintaining equipment, managing land, and assisting with crop production. These roles may require physical labor, long hours, and a variety of skills, from animal husbandry to machinery operation. Employees might live on-site and are essential to the daily operations and long-term success of the ranch. Full-time ranch workers typically work year-round and play a crucial role in rural agricultural communities.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a full time ranch hand?

To thrive as a Full-Time Ranch Hand, you need practical experience in animal care, equipment operation, and general maintenance,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with tools like tractors, irrigation systems, and sometimes basic livestock management software is valuable. Dependability, physical stamina, and strong problem-solving skills set outstanding ranch hands apart. These skills ensure the smooth daily operation, safety, and productivity of the ranch environment.

What are common challenges faced by employees working full time on a ranch, and how can they be addressed?

Full-time ranch work often involves physically demanding tasks, long hours, and working outdoors in varying weather conditions. Employees may face challenges such as fatigue, unpredictable daily routines due to livestock needs, and the need for quick problem-solving when unexpected issues arise. To address these challenges, it's important to maintain good physical fitness, develop time management skills, and foster strong communication with team members. Many ranches also prioritize safety training and provide opportunities for workers to learn new skills, which can help employees adapt and thrive in this dynamic environment.

How much money can you make working on a full time ranch?

Full-time ranch workers typically earn between $25,000 and $45,000 annually, depending on experience, location, and responsibilities. Skilled roles such as livestock managers or equipment operators may earn higher wages, and benefits like housing or meals are sometimes included in compensation packages.

How to get into full time ranch work with no experience?

Full time ranch work often requires physical stamina and a willingness to learn hands-on skills such as animal care, fencing, and equipment operation. Gaining experience through volunteering, assisting on small farms, or completing relevant certifications like CPR or livestock handling can improve chances of employment. Starting with entry-level positions and demonstrating reliability can lead to more advanced roles over time.

Job description

Heritage Ranch Golf and Country Club is excited to announce the exceptional career opportunities for a full-time Bartender. Qualified candidates will thrive in a hospitality environment and be highly focused on providing superior service.
Key Responsibilities of the Bartender:
  • Stocks bar, mixes and serves alcoholic beverages, assists in cost control, inventory and maintaining inventory records.
  • Maintains inventory control through conscientious use and careful monitoring of all food and beverage products and communicates with management in a timely manner when supplies are needed.
  • Ensures compliance with applicable state liquor laws and standard operating procedures provided by the management.
  • Communicates guest requests and concerns to the Department Manager.
  • Performs opening and closing duties which include, but are not limited to: inventory, cash control, cleaning, and restocking.
  • Accountable for checks and cash transactions. Utilizes Point of Sales System.
  • Reviews banquet schedule for changes, calendar of events, and special events.
  • Serves catered parties from service or portable bars.
  • Occasionally serves meals to guests.
  • Incorporates safe work practices in job performance.
  • Performs other duties as required.

2 YEAR MINIMUM BARTENDING EXPERIENCE:
  • High school diploma or general education degree (GED); and one year of bartending exper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Must be at least 21 years of age or older to meet state age requirements to serve alcohol.

Other Qualifications:
  • Possesses knowledge of cocktail recipes and wine varieties.
  • Alcohol Awareness Training.
